>Oluniyi Ajao’s Report from Ghanablogging Session

December 22, 2009 No Comments

>
Here are the excellent notes from the session I led on blogging yesterday, courtesy of Oluniyi David Ajao, one of the most successful bloggers out of Ghana.

Noteworthy is also that 24 people signed up to receive more information about ghanablogging.com after the session. Yihaa!
